Abstract

Investigations were undertaken to study the response of spider mite Tetranychus turkestani Ugarov and Nikolskii to chemical fertilizers applied in different combinations on cowpea. Six combinations of N, P, K and S were tried during Kharif season 2003. Mite population was significantly high (12.65 to 50.09 leaf−1) in plots treated with chemical fertilizers in comparison to untreated control (7.58 motile mites leaf−1). Treatment combination of N30P80S10 harboured greater mites (50.09 leaf−1), followed by K-treated plots (12.65 to 31.70 mites leaf−1). The treatments containing N, P and S carried high mite population on the crop than K-treated plots. Mite population (7.58 leaf−1) and egg number (16.06 leaf−1) was less in untreated cowpea plots as compared to fertilizer treated plots (12.65–50.09 mite leaf −1 and 19.34–55.09 eggs leaf−1). A direct relationship between fertilizer application to the cowpea and population of T. turkestani was noticed.
